Cat s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a cat sitter in Superior on Rover as of Aug 2025 was about $20 per night,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A cat sitter’s rate may also change as you customize your booking to fit your and your cat’s needs.
As of Aug 2025, there are 54 cat sitters in Superior. You can filter, sort, expand your radius, read reviews, and compare pricing to find the perfect cat sitter near you. As a reminder, cat sitters joining Rover must pass a background check for you and your cat’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to reach out to multiple cat sitters about your booking. Typically, 81% of Superior cat sitters respond in under an hour.
Cat sitters in Superior have an average of 14 years of experience. Cat sitters with repeat customers have an average of 4 repeat clients.
